An Agent that acts as an MCP client — dynamically connects to remote MCP servers, handles OAuth authentication, and aggregates tools, prompts, and resources from all connected servers.
addMcpServer/removeMcpServer— managing MCP server connections from an AgentonMcpUpdate— real-time state updates pushed to the React frontend via WebSocketthis.mcp.configureElicitationHandlers— when a server requests input mid-tool-call (elicitation), the Agent registers form and url handlers that broadcast requests to the browser; the human's answer resolves the pending tool call via a@callablemethod- OAuth popup flow —
configureOAuthCallbackwith a custom handler that closes the popup after auth agentFetch— making HTTP requests to the Agent's custom endpoints from the client

npm run startThe UI lets you add MCP server URLs, see their connection state, browse their tools, prompts, and resources, and run tools. If a tool call triggers an elicitation, a card appears asking for your input.
To test with an authenticated server, run the mcp-worker-authenticated example alongside this one and add its URL. To test elicitation, run the mcp-elicitation example's server, add it here (the MCP endpoint is at /mcp, e.g. http://localhost:8787/mcp), and run its increase-counter (form-mode) or connect-account (url-mode) tool from this UI.

cp .env.example .envThe Agent manages MCP connections via the built-in mcp property:
export class MyAgent extends Agent {
onStart() {
this.mcp.configureOAuthCallback({
customHandler: (result) => {
if (result.authSuccess) {
return new Response("<script>window.close();</script>", {
headers: { "content-type": "text/html" }
});
}
return new Response(`Auth failed: ${result.authError}`, {
status: 400
});
}
});
}
async onRequest(request) {
// Custom endpoints for the frontend
if (url.pathname.endsWith("add-mcp")) {
const { name, url } = await request.json();
await this.addMcpServer(name, url);
return new Response("Ok");
}
}
}The React frontend uses useAgent with onMcpUpdate to receive real-time server state:
const agent = useAgent({
agent: "my-agent",
name: sessionId,
onMcpUpdate: (mcpServers) => setMcpState(mcpServers),
onOpen: () => setConnected(true)
});mcp— stateful MCP server (good target to connect to)mcp-worker-authenticated— authenticated server (tests the OAuth flow)
